WebInvolving families helps ensure sensitivity to cultural, service, and support needs. Child and Family Services Reviews have found that a significantly higher percentage of children have permanency and stability in their living situations in States that rated strongly in developing case plans jointly with parents. WebFamily support programs provide welcoming, community- based opportunities for families to voluntarily come together and exchange support. Programs are flexible and can respond to a range of unique family needs. Professionals partner with families and collaborate with local organizations.
